Polkerris to Fowey (4.5 miles - medium difficulty)

Parking can be found in the pay and display car park above Polkerris and head back down into the village. Turn left past a building signed 'JCSR1912'. Where the path forks, bear left and go up the hill. Follow the signs up the steps and on through a wooded area. After this the path continues into a field; here you should bear right where signed, through a kissing gate into the next field. Follow the path down to a further kissing gate above a cove. This is followed by a further kissing gate and a stile. Continue on towards Little Gribbin, crossing another stile and passing Platt beach. You will come to another stile now; after this, continue on the path. At the fork in the path, bear right and go through the next kissing gate. Head towards the tower then drop down towards Polridmouth. Ignoring the stile to the right, carry on through a further kissing gate and across several boardwalks to Polridmouth beach. The path will fork again here; take the path to the right and walk on to another beach with a lake. Cross this lake using the stepping stones, and then bear off to the right just before reaching the large metal gate. Continue on up the path and climb another stile to get into the field. Walk along the right hand side of the field to the gate, and then continue following the path along Southground Cliffs. You will reach a boardwalk and stile; carry on through another kissing gate and down the steps to Coombe Haven. Leave Coombe Haven via the steep steps and over another stile into a field. Pass the 'Alldays' plinth and leave the field through the kissing gate. Now ignore the path to the right and continue straight on. The path will then take you down through woodland to join the road at Readymoney Cove.
